Runbook: Scanline barcode bridge

If warehouse scans stop flowing into Cartwheel, it's almost always the bridge service on the Dunmore floor box wedging after a USB hiccup. Bounce the service first — nine times out of ten that fixes it. If not, check the queue depth before escalating. When restarting, make sure the bridge comes up with these settings.

deployment values, yafop-bajef:
[gilok]
team = ulaius
access_code = ac_423664
host = gilok.sivrelhq.corp
port = 9200
owner = pelius.istax
peer = eliok.torvasoft.internal

### Fire-Drill Roll Call — Facilities Desk

During drills at Orrin House, the facilities desk carries the master register to the east courtyard. Account for every department head before reporting to the chief warden, and record absences precisely. Once the all-clear sounds, readmit staff through the courtyard door using the code below.

staff pass of kawip-hawef = bdg-QLP-2

**Mgmt Meeting Minutes — Retiring the Brightline Range**

Quick recap for sales leads at Fenholt Supplies: we agreed to retire the Brightline fixture range by year-end. Remaining stock moves to clearance pricing next month, and accounts on standing orders get migrated to the Lumetta range. Trade-in incentives were approved in principle. The confidential note on next steps sits just below.

board note of bajof-bajeg: The pricing group signed off on a budget of $13.4 million for Project Sildor. The renewal with Lamixek Holdings closes at $48.9 million a year, 49 percent above the last contract.